接口 com.taobao.metamorphosis.client.transaction.TransactionSession
的使用

使用 TransactionSession 的软件包
com.taobao.metamorphosis.client.extension.producer   
com.taobao.metamorphosis.client.producer   
com.taobao.metamorphosis.client.transaction   
 

com.taobao.metamorphosis.client.extension.producerTransactionSession 的使用
 

实现 TransactionSessioncom.taobao.metamorphosis.client.extension.producer 中的类
 class AsyncMetaMessageProducer
           异步单向发送消息给服务器的生产者实现.
 class OrderedMessageProducer
           有序消息生产者的实现类,需要按照消息内容(例如某个id)散列到固定分区并要求有序的场景中使用.
 

com.taobao.metamorphosis.client.producerTransactionSession 的使用
 

实现 TransactionSessioncom.taobao.metamorphosis.client.producer 中的类
 class SimpleMessageProducer
          消费生产者实现
 class SimpleXAMessageProducer
          XA消息生产者的实现类
 

com.taobao.metamorphosis.client.transactionTransactionSession 的使用
 

参数类型为 TransactionSessioncom.taobao.metamorphosis.client.transaction 中的构造方法
TransactionContext(com.taobao.gecko.service.RemotingClient remotingClient, String serverUrl, TransactionSession session, LongSequenceGenerator localTransactionIdGenerator, int transactionTimeout, long transactionRequestTimeoutInMills)
           
 



Copyright © 2010–2013. All rights reserved.